Dimethyl 4,5-di­chloro­phthalate

While endeavoring to synthesize new chlorinated ligands for ruthenium-based metathesis catalysts, the title compound dimethyl 4,5-di­chloro­phthalate, C10H8Cl2O4, was prepared from commercially available 4,5-di­chloro­phthalic acid in ∼77% yield. The title mol­ecule, which also finds utility as a precursor mol­ecule for the synthesis of drugs used in the treatment of Alzheimer's disease, shows one carbonyl-containing methyl ester moiety lying nearly co-planar with the chlorine-derivatized aromatic ring while the second methyl ester shows a significant deviation of 101.05 (12)° from the least-squares plane of the aromatic ring. Within the crystal, structural integrity is maintained by the concerted effects of electrostatic inter­actions involving the electron-deficient carbonyl carbon atom and the electron-rich aromatic ring along the a-axis direction and C—H⋯O hydrogen bonds between neighboring mol­ecules parallel to b.
